The mod in question is called ‘First Person Souls - Full Game Conversion’ and is the work of a group of modders dubbed ‘The First Person Souls Project’, who are seemingly led by Dasaav. Their sole previous creation brought a first-person camera to Dark Souls 3.

This time, they’ve done the same to Elden Ring, giving players the chance to: “experience Elden Ring like you have never before” by viewing it “with your own eyes”, as is demonstrated in the trailer below.

As you can see, every boss battle the game has to offer can be tried out from this new perspective, with a bunch of gameplay mechanics having been adjusted by the First Person Souls team, in order to ensure things feel as “seamless and polished” as possible during these frenetic fights.

Among these changes are the addition of custom HUD elements, the integration of animated head tracking, plus some revisions of how the player character moves and aims, all of which you can tweak to suit your personal preferences via in-game menus or the mod’s INI file.

Those keen to experience their fresh viewpoint with friends will be glad to hear that the mod supports online play via LukeYui’s ‘Seamless Co-op’, allowing you to feel a little less small and alone, even while lurking in the shadows of the game’s towering architecture or taking on a creature several times larger than you are.
